The US House of Representatives has agreed to hold billionaire Leon Black in contempt of Congress for defying legal summons related to its investigation into convicted sex offender Jeffrey Epstein. Black - who had business ties to Epstein - did not comply with a subpoena ordering him to appear before the House Oversight Committee earlier this month and share documents related to Epstein. Lawyers for Black, who has sued over the summons, called the contempt move "outrageous". After passage of the measure holding Black in contempt, Oversight Committee Chairman James Comer said: "No one is above the law." "We will continue to seek transparency for the American people and justice for survivors.
